Danish design at your fingertips.
It’s a classic flatware look: The flat-ended stems that resemble oars from a quiet Nordic lakeside cabin, or maybe the head of a guitar you’d strum on the docks. The Sixten flatware set takes in all of that and pares it down to essentials...just a hint of an inflection point, and no hard angles to be found. It’s essential Danish design for everyday eating, the kind you’ll wanna pull out for all three meals—at a price that lets you stock up on them.
